摘要:
The invention is relates to drugs on the basis of antibodies against non-cellular bone matrix proteins, especially BSP, for use in the prevention and treatment of bone metastases. According to the invention, the antibodies are induced in the patient by recombinantly expressing antigenic determinants of bone matrix proteins in Listeria and anchoring them on the surfaces thereof. The antigenic determinants are selected according to whether they are characteristic of antigens that are expressed by the tumor cells themselves.

摘要:
The present invention relates to a method for producing carrier microorganisms, in particular bacteria, which, through targeted genetic manipulation, carry epitopes or epitomers, respectively, on their surfaces. Epitomers are antigenically effective epitopes that can be found in the polypeptide chain in multiple identical copies, and which, when expressed on the surface of the bacteria, can be used for immunization with particular success. A further aspect relates to correspondingly produced bacteria and their uses as vaccines, in particular in cancer therapy.
